The Ascent of Arjun - The Empire of Dharma

# The Epic of Arjun - Synopsis ## Setting The dense forests of Dandakaranyam in ancient Bharath, where traditional ways of life and the code of dharma still govern the land. ## Main Characters **Arjun** - A sixteen-year-old with the classical heroic build of ajanubahu (arms extending to his knees), trained in combat and archery. Despite his warrior training, he has a compassionate heart that abhors unnecessary killing. **Devavrath** - Arjun's grandfather and mentor, a formidable warrior whose true identity remains mysterious. Though aging and ill, he possesses extraordinary combat skills and deep wisdom about threats facing the motherland. ## Plot Summary Young Arjun lives a secluded life in the forest with his grandfather Devavrath, undergoing rigorous training in archery and combat. When his grandfather falls ill, Arjun ventures into forbidden territory to gather rare medicinal herbs, despite warnings about the dangers that lurk there. In the tiger's domain, Arjun encounters a fierce tigress protecting her two cubs. The tigress, already wounded from territorial battles and desperate to protect her young, attacks the intruder. Faced with an impossible choice, Arjun reluctantly kills the tigress in self-defense but saves her orphaned cubs, bringing them home to raise as his own responsibility. This act of compassion comes with a price - Devavrath demands that Arjun double his training efforts. Through increasingly challenging exercises, including hitting targets while dodging his grandfather's attacks, Arjun's skills are pushed to their limits. As the training intensifies, Devavrath reveals a shocking truth: Arjun is not just a forest dweller but a Kshatriya with a destined role to protect Bharath from foreign threats that are gathering in the shadows. The rigorous training is preparation for a greater purpose - to defend the motherland from "foreign beasts" who wait to strike. ## Central Themes - **Dharma vs. Personal Desire**: Arjun's struggle between his natural compassion and his duty as a warrior - **Responsibility and Sacrifice**: Taking responsibility for consequences of one's actions (raising the tiger cubs) - **Hidden Destiny**: The revelation that Arjun's simple forest life is actually preparation for a greater calling - **Master-Student Bond**: The deep relationship between Devavrath and Arjun, built on trust, wisdom, and unspoken secrets ## Conflicts **Internal**: Arjun's moral conflict about killing and his confusion about his true identity and purpose **External**: The immediate physical challenges of survival and training, with hints of a larger conflict brewing for the future **Generational**: The tension between Devavrath's knowledge of greater threats and Arjun's current innocence about the wider world ## Story Questions - What is Arjun's true heritage and why is it being kept secret? - What are the "foreign beasts" that threaten Bharath? - Why is Devavrath's time running out, and what will happen when he's gone? - How will Arjun's compassionate nature reconcile with his warrior destiny? ## Tone Epic and mythological, blending intense action sequences with philosophical depth. The narrative carries the weight of ancient Indian storytelling traditions while exploring timeless themes of duty, sacrifice, and the price of protecting what one loves. This opening chapter establishes Arjun as a reluctant hero whose journey from compassionate youth to defender of dharma promises to be both physically and spiritually transformative.

Phantom Weaver of the Veiled Eclipse

Inola was just your typical beast kin orphan—ears too sharp, stomach too empty, and dreams far too big for the crumbling orphanage she called home. The place was run by a greasy baron with a combover and a crooked smile, who made sure the kids knew the value of silence, obedience, and cheap labor. But today—today was her thirteenth birthday. And somehow, today also happened to be the day she found herself standing in a line stretching halfway across the capital, clutching a ticket made of black silk and gilded gold leaf. Her fingers trembled just holding it. Everyone else in line stared like she’d grown wings and started breathing fire. She still didn’t know how this happened. All she did was help a sweet old lady cross the road yesterday. The carts had been fast, the rain had been pouring, and she’d nearly slipped twice. But the old lady had smiled, warm as cinnamon bread, and handed her the strange ticket without another word before disappearing into the alleyways. It wasn’t until this morning that Inola learned who that old woman was. The former Queen of Vaerindale. Disguised and wandering the city for her own mysterious reasons. And that ticket? A personal invitation—one of only thirteen—to enter the newly discovered Mythic Dungeon before anyone else. A dungeon no one had survived exploring. A dungeon rumored to contain Essence Stones—ancient artifacts of unimaginable power, used to forge custom classes with limitless potential. And Inola, ragged boots and patched coat and all, was going in as a scout. Well… whatever. Life hadn’t exactly offered her many handouts before, so this? This was a miracle. And she wasn’t about to waste it. Her claws flexed. Her tail twitched with anticipation. “I’m going to make a better life for myself. Even if I have to claw it out of the dungeon with my bare hands.” Read as this fox kin becomes the most powerful illusion-type classer as she masters how to bend reality with her Phantom Weaver of the Veiled Eclipse class.
